The Queens walk away with a shootout victory in Llodyminster
Lloydminster, February 3, 2023 – As the Red Deer Polytechnic Queens hockey team headed north to battle with the newly-added Lakeland College Rustlers, they were going to be put to the test as the Rustlers are coming off two wins against the NAIT Ooks, who are sitting in first place. The Ooks are a team the Queens have only beaten once in three games.
The Rustlers opened the scoring in their own building to go up 1-0.
But, forward Alli Soyko (Bachelor of Education) tied the up game and scored her second goal of the season. Forward Arilyn Toews and defense Kaedence Mollin (Bachelor of Science in Nursing) got the assists on the Queens first goal of the game.
Moments into the second period, forward Madison Sansom (Social Work) scored to take the Queens lead back. This would extend Sansom's point streak to six games. Forward Natalie Buttle (Bachelor of Kinesiology) got the lone assist on RDP's second goal of the game.
After the Rustlers tied it up, the two teams went to the dressing room for the last time tied at two. But the Queens were outshooting Lakeland College 30-23.
This game would need overtime. This happens to be the second time these two teams needed extra time to find a winner with the Rustlers winning that game 1-0. At the end of three periods, the Queens continued to outshoot Lakeland 41-27.
The first period of overtime went scoreless which meant another period was needed.
The biggest save of the game came in extra time as goaltender Izzy Palumbo robbed the Rustlers forward on a breakaway with her glove to give her team a chance to come home with a win.
After 20 minutes to play, the game needed a shootout and the Queens scored twice to win it 3-2.
Buttle scored the first goal and forward Jailyn Bablitz (Bachelor of Education) scored the game-winning goal in the shootout.
